Deciphering the Mcp6004 Datasheet A Comprehensive Guide

The Mcp6004 Datasheet serves as the definitive guide for anyone looking to integrate the MCP6004 quad op-amp into their electronic designs. It provides a wealth of information, ranging from basic functional descriptions to detailed electrical characteristics. Think of it as the instruction manual for a complex piece of hardware. Its primary function is to provide engineers and hobbyists with all the necessary data to properly implement the MCP6004 and ensure optimal performance in their applications. This includes information about:

  • Pin configurations and descriptions
  • Absolute maximum ratings (voltages, currents, temperatures)
  • Electrical characteristics (input offset voltage, input bias current, gain bandwidth product)
  • Typical performance curves
  • Application examples

These datasheets are used in a multitude of ways. First and foremost, they inform the component selection process. By carefully reviewing the electrical characteristics detailed in the datasheet, designers can determine if the MCP6004’s specifications meet the requirements of their specific application. For instance, if a circuit requires a very low input bias current, the datasheet will provide the necessary data to assess the suitability of the MCP6004. Furthermore, during the design phase, the datasheet helps with calculating appropriate resistor values, setting up feedback networks, and ensuring stable operation. Proper understanding of the datasheet guarantees the op-amp is operated within its safe operating area and does not exceed its limits.

Beyond the design phase, the Mcp6004 Datasheet is crucial for troubleshooting and debugging circuits. If a circuit isn’t performing as expected, the datasheet can be used to verify that the MCP6004 is being operated within its specified parameters. A quick look at the absolute maximum ratings can reveal if the component was accidentally over-volted or over-heated, leading to potential damage. The datasheet also includes typical performance curves, which can be used to compare the actual circuit performance against the expected performance.
